发明名称 Method and device for recognizing faults in a photovoltaic system
摘要 The invention relates to a method and a device for recognizing faults in a photovoltaic system (1). A first output voltage (U0, UMPP) of the system (1) and/or a first parameter derived from the output voltage (U0, UMPP) is determined at a first point in time in a first operating state of the photovoltaic system (1). At a second point in time in a second operating state comparable to the first operating state, a second output voltage (U0, UMPP) and/or a second parameter of the system (1) derived from the output voltage (U0, UMPP) is determined. Finally, a deviation between the first and the second output voltage (U0, UMPP) and/or between the first and the second parameter is identified and a fault notification is output if the deviation exceeds a predeterminable threshold.

主权项 1. A method for recognizing faults in a photovoltaic system, comprising the steps: determining a first parameter derived from a first output voltage of the photovoltaic system at a first time point in a first operating state of the photovoltaic-system for determining a starting condition during an initialization process, determining a second parameter derived from a second output voltage of the photovoltaic system at a second time point, when a weather analysis for establishing a sun radiation above a threshold leads to a positive result and there is a second operating state comparable with the first operating state, wherein the weather analysis is performed by using output data from the inverter and without using a light sensitive sensor or a radiation sensor, and wherein the weather analysis is considered to be positive if a power output of the inverter is above 15% of the respective nominal power, determining a deviation between the first and second parameter and outputting an error message when the deviation exceeds a predeterminable threshold, wherein each of the first parameter and the second parameter is the ratio between the maximum power point voltage and the open circuit voltage of the photovoltaic system.
